Output e87ecfc222c533cfd75a755a6f5ac26202e26ab3950cb3a6fe713247ef4e248c:4

value
666196
script pubkey
OP_0 OP_PUSHBYTES_20 c2790dc936aa105be4c95947d9616885b80d93ac
address
bc1qcfusmjfk4gg9hexft9rajctgskuqmyavfpflpm
transaction
e87ecfc222c533cfd75a755a6f5ac26202e26ab3950cb3a6fe713247ef4e248c
spent
true